The black spot on the side of the John Dory is a defensive measure, used to confuse predators by fooling them into thinking they are looking at the eye and head of a much larger fish. John Dory on sale at a fish market in Santiago de Compostela, Spain. John Dory is an edible fish and are of increasing commercial importance in waters where they are common, where they may be targeted by trawlers or retained if they are caught as bycatch when fishing for other species.

They are sold on fresh fish counters at fishmongers and there is a growing demand from upmarket restaurants who want to put John Dory on their menus. The flesh is firm and has a delicate, mild flavour, although the amount of edible flesh on a John Dory is only about a third of its overall weight.

There is little information on the state of John Dory stocks and fishing for this species is mostly unregulated. The International Union for the Conservation of Nature has not been able to gather enough information to make an assessment on the stocks of John Dory, meaning they are classed as Data Deficient on both a global and European level. However, it is believed to be locally abundant in many areas of its range, and its wide distribution means that it is protected to a certain extend from overfishing.

John Dory will go for lures, as well as fish strip which flutters in the tide. Any John Dory caught from the shore is noteworthy, underlined by the fact that the British shore caught record is currently vacant the qualifying weight is set at 3lbs.
